Do the new DV3,4,5 graphic cards like Nvidia 9200gs, 9300gs play newer games? I want to play NHL 09, Nba 2k9, Crysis, Call of duty etc. I know that Crysis will be demanding but other games, would I be able to run at high settings?
-
The 9200GS is an IGP, so it won't run higher end 3D games like CoD4 or Crysis very well, if at all.
The 9300M GS isn't much better, although it does have 256MB of discrete memory - it should be able to run the other games you mentioned at medium-high settings (just disable anti-aliasing and shadows). -
MY DV5 has a dedicated 9600mGT 512MB DDR2, RUNS CoD4 all settings high with no AA, at around 35-45 fps with full server. With Source Games High 90's with full GFX no AA. Take a look at the GFX list on this website. It will tell you the specs of the video cards in question. It will help you decide what one is right for you. Don't be swayed by the name either. A 8600MGT will beat out a 9300MGS no problem..
